# MySQL群集部署实现指南
## 概述
在本文中,我将向你介绍MySQL群集部署的过程和步骤。我们将使用一些常用的工具和技术来实现高可用性和负载均衡。
## MySQL群集部署流程
下面是实现MySQL群集部署的一般步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 准备服务器 |
| 2 | 安装MySQL |
| 3 | 配置主服务器 |
| 4 | 配置从服务
原创
2023-11-01 04:48:07
50阅读
Memcached群集部署一、Memcached群集概述 Memcached本身是基于内存的缓存,它的设计本身没用冗余机制。如果一个Memcached节点失去了所有的数据,理论上后端的应用程序可以从数据源中再次获取到数据。如果担心节点失效会大大加重数据库的负担,可以增加更多的节点来减少丢失一个节点的影响,热备节点在其
原创
2016-08-25 15:05:29
2251阅读
RabbitMQ 简介 MQ全称为Message Queue, 消息队列(MQ)是一种应用程序对应用程序的通信方法。应用程序通过读写出入队列的消息(针对应用程序的数据)来通信,而无需专用连接来链接它们。消息传递指的是程序之间通过在消息中发送数据进行通信,而不是通过直接调用彼此来通信,直接调用通常是用于诸如远程过程调用的技术。排队指的是应用程序通过 队列来通信。队列的使用除去了接收
原创
2018-10-22 23:15:30
646阅读
点赞
实验环境用两台服务器模拟6台服务器(添加网卡)主服务器Redis1:ens33:192.168.52.150ens36:192.168.52.153ens37:192.168.52.154从服务器Redis2:ens33:192.168.52.148ens36:192.168.52.155ens37:192.168.52.156在两台服务器上都安装Redis[root@localhost~]#yu
原创
2019-12-28 22:36:04
398阅读
一、Redis群集相关概念Redis是从3.0版本开始支持cluter的,采用的是hash槽方式,可以将多个Redis实例整合在一起,形成一个群集,也就是将数据分散存储到群集中的多个节点上。Redis的cluster是一个无中心的结构,在群集中,每个master的身份是平等的,每个节点都保存数据和整个群集的状态,并且知道其他节点所负责的槽,也会定时发送心跳信息,能够及时感知群集中异常的节点,并且采
原创
2020-02-13 11:49:06
640阅读
一、Redis群集相关概念Redis是从3.0版本开始支持cluter的,采用的是hash槽方式,可以将多个Redis实例整合在一起,形成一个群集,也就是将数据分散存储到群集中的多个节点上。Redis的cluster是一个无中心的结构,在群集中,每个master的身份是平等的,每个节点都保存数据和整个群集的状态,并且知道其他节点所负责的槽,也会定时发送心跳信息,能够及时感知群集中异常的节点,并且采
原创
2020-02-14 16:49:40
375阅读
一、环境准备主机名IP运行服务kafka1192.168.171.131kafka+zookeeperkafka2192.168.171.134kafka+zookeeperkafka3192.168.171.135kafka+zookeeper二、部署zookeeper服务源码包(提取码:6q58)1、kafka1配置如下#部署zookeeper[root@kafka1~]#tarzxfzook
原创
精选
2020-05-07 12:08:08
2616阅读
一、Rabbitmq概念RabbitMQ是一个开源的靠AMQP协议实现的服务,服务器端用Erlang语言编写,支持多种客户端,如:Python、Ruby、.NET、Java、JMS、C、PHP、ActionScript、XMPP、STOMP等,支持AJAX。用于在分布式系统中存储转发消息,在易用性、扩展性、高可用性等方面表现不俗。AMQP,即AdvancedMessageQueuingProtoc
原创
2019-11-23 11:53:32
1338阅读
Mencached基本部署Mamcached概述memcached是一套分布式的高速缓存系统,运行在内存中。memcached缺乏认证以及安全管制,这代表应该将memcached服务器放置在防火墙后。实验准备名称角色地址centos7-1服务端192.168.142.66centos7-2客户端192.168.142.77实验步骤memcached服务端安装环境包[root@localhostli
原创
2019-12-27 08:40:32
939阅读
点赞
一、部署Rabbitmq集群Rabbitmq集群大概分为两种方式:1、普通模式:默认的集群模式,消息的尸体只存在一个节点上;2、镜像模式:把需要的队列做成镜像,存在于多个节点。ha-mode:all:列队到所有节点;exatly:随机镜像到其他节点上;nodes:镜像到指定节点上。集群节点模式:1、内存节点:工作在内存上;2、磁盘节点:工作在磁盘上;例外:内存节点和磁盘节点共同存在,提高访问速度的
原创
2020-04-01 10:14:15
671阅读
MySQL数据库的集群方案MySQL 高可用架构:主从备份
为了防止数据库的突然,挂机,我们需要对数据库进行高可用架构 主从备份 是常见的场景通常情况下都是 一主一从/(多从) 正常情况下,都是主机进行工作,从机进行备份主机数据,如果主机某天突然意外宕机,从机可以立刻工作而不会数据丢失…MySql 主从复制原理mysql主节点(称master) | 从(称slave)复制首先我们要先开启主机的 日
转载
2023-09-07 21:56:27
250阅读
一、Redis群集相关概念Redis是从3.0版本开始支持cluter的,采用的是hash槽方式,可以将多个Redis实例整合在一起,形成一个群集,也就是将数据分散存储到群集中的多个节点上。Redis的cluster是一个无中心的结构,在群集中,每个master的身份是平等的,每个节点都保存数据和整个群集的状态,并且知道其他节点所负责的槽,也会定时发送心跳信息,能够及时感知群集中异常的节点,并且采
原创
2019-11-05 01:22:53
4232阅读
何为MMM? MMM(Master-Master replication manager for Mysql,Mysql 主主复制管理器)是一套支持双主故障切换和双主日常管理的脚本程序。MMM使用Perl语言开发,主要用来监控和管理Mysql Master-Master(双主)复制,虽然叫做双主复制,但是业务上同一时刻只允许对一个主进行写入,另一台备选主上提供部分读服务,以加速在主主切换时备选主
原创
2018-09-10 13:33:30
1250阅读
点赞
前言在实际生产环境中,如果对mysql数据库的读和写都在一台数据库服务器中操作,无论是在安全性、高可用性,还是高并发等各个方面都是不能满足实际需求的,一般要通过主从复制的方式来同步数据,再通过读写分离来提升数据库的并发负载能力。1、数据备份 - 热备份&容灾&高可用 2、读写分离,支持更大的并发 文章目录前言原理介绍问题配置常见错误 原理介绍主从复制的流程:两个日志(binlog二
转载
2023-12-09 14:17:06
75阅读
一、Keepalived工具介绍 专为LVS和HA设计的一款健康检查工具 支持故障自动切换(Failover) 支持节点健康状态检查(Health Checking) 官方网站:http://www.keepalived.org/ 二、Keepalived工作原理 Keepalived 是一个基于V ...
转载
2021-08-22 23:54:00
88阅读
2评论
LVS+Keepalived 群集部署 一、Keepalived工具介绍 二、Keepalived工作原理 三、部署LVS+Keepalived 高可用群集 1.配置负载调度器(主、备相同;192.168.30.12;192.168.30.13) 2.部署共享存储(NFS服务器:192.168.30 ...
转载
2021-08-22 22:00:00
78阅读
2评论
LVS负载均衡群集部署一、企业群集应用概述群集的含义Cluster,集群、群集由多台主机构成,但对外只表现为一个整体1.1群集的三种类型负载均衡群集、高可用群集和高性能运算群集。1.1负载均衡群集提高应用系统的响应能力、尽可能处理更多的访问请求、减少延迟为目标,获得高并发、高负载(LB)的整体性能LB的负载分配依赖于主节点的分流算法1.2高可用群集提高应用系统的可靠性、尽可能地减少中断时间为目标,
原创
2022-02-16 13:53:51
196阅读
一、Redis群集架构细节:1、所有的Redis节点彼此互联(PING-PONG机制)内部使用二进制协议优先传输速度和带宽。2、节点的失效(fail)在群集中超过半数的主(master)节点检测失效时才会生效。3、客户端与redis节点直连,不需要中间代理(proxy)层,客户端不需要连接群集所有节点,连接群集中任何一个可用节点即可。4、redis-cluster把所有的物理节点映射到[0-163
原创
2019-09-22 21:56:52
1062阅读
点赞
1、Master组件●kube-apiserverKubernetesAPI,集群的统一入口,各组件协调者,以RESTfulAPI提供接口服务,所有对象资源的增删改查和监听操作都交给APIServer处理后再提交给Etcd存储。●kube-controller-manager处理集群中常规后台任务,一个资源对应一个控制器,而ControllerManager就是负责管理这些控制器的。●kube-s
原创
2020-01-16 11:48:12
10000+阅读
点赞
注:本博文只用于实现简单群集配置,更深入的资料可以参考官方文档Elasticsearch官方文档kibana官方文档一、准备工作环境如下系统IP服务Centos7.3192.168.171.131ES1、logstash、ES-Head、logstash、kibanaCentos7.3192.168.171.134ES2Centos7.3192.168.171.135ES31、配置域名解析[roo
原创
精选
2020-05-08 07:48:49
3330阅读